html文件中编写一个可以读取Access 数据库的函数,函数名为getlocations
时间: 2023-06-20 07:06:49 浏览: 66
假设您使用的是JavaScript语言,可以使用以下代码编写一个可以读取Access数据库的函数:
```javascript
function getlocations() {
// 创建一个 ActiveXObject 对象
var conn = new ActiveXObject("ADODB.Connection");
// 数据库连接字符串
var connStr =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=your_database_path;";
// 打开数据库连接
conn.Open(connStr);
// SQL 查询语句
var sql = "SELECT * FROM your_table_name;";
// 执行查询
var rs = conn.Execute(sql);
// 存储查询结果的数组
var result = [];
// 将查询结果添加到数组中
while (!rs.EOF) {
var location = {
id: rs.Fields("id").Value,
name: rs.Fields("name").Value,
address: rs.Fields("address").Value,
city: rs.Fields("city").Value,
state: rs.Fields("state").Value,
zip: rs.Fields("zip").Value
};
result.push(location);
rs.MoveNext();
}
// 关闭查询结果集和数据库连接
rs.Close();
conn.Close();
// 返回查询结果数组
return result;
}
```
请将 `your_database_path` 替换为您的Access数据库文件的路径,将 `your_table_name` 替换为您要查询的表名。此函数将返回一个包含查询结果的数组,每个元素都是一个包含地点信息的对象。